Which of the following is NOT a 'Shabdhalankara' (verbal ornament)?

  1. A
    Shlesh
  2. B
    Rupak
  3. C
    Anupras
  4. D
    Yamak

Solution & Step-by-step Explanation

In Hindi poetics, figures of speech (Alankara) are broadly classified into two major groups:
1. Shabdhalankara: Where the beauty of the poetry depends entirely on the specific words used. Examples include:
* Anupras (Alliteration)
* Yamak (Repetition of words with different meanings)
* Shlesh (Punning/Double meaning on a single word word)

2. Arthalankara: Where the poetic beauty arises from the intrinsic meaning of the words rather than the letters themselves.
* Rupak (Metaphor) belongs to Arthalankara, as it sets an absolute identity between the upameya and upamana based on meaning.

Therefore, Rupak is not a Shabdhalankara.
